Gold Rises to One-Month High
Saturday, 29 November 2025 03:32 WIB | GOLD EMAS

Gold surged past $4,220 an ounce on Friday (November 28th) to a one-month high and is on track for a fourth straight monthly gain as markets price in a higher probability of a Fed rate cut in December. Dovish statements from several Fed officials and the release of delayed economic data showing weakness have reinforced expectations of easing. Gold Heads for Fourth Monthly Gain; Silver Hits New Record High
Friday, 28 November 2025 23:23 WIB | GOLD EMAS

Spot gold prices rose 1% to a two-week high on Friday (November 28th), as expectations that the Federal Reserve will cut interest rates next month boosted demand for the non-yielding asset, while silver hit a new record high. Spot gold prices rose 0.9% to $4,192.78 an ounce at 10:09 a.m. ET (1510 GMT), the highest since November 14th, and are expected to post a weekly gain of 2.9%. Bullion prices, which are expected to gain 4.6% this month, are on track for their fourth consecutive monthly gain.
